After the new version of McAfee was installed, I can no longer see WebCams due to firewall. I have all the .EXE programs in Yahoo marked as having full access (in McAfee), but it doesn't matter.

You need to set your webcam executable as "allowed" in the firewall connections. I don't have McAfee, but my Security Suite, and others as well, have a section which lists all the programs and hardware which have access to the internet. It could be that somehow the webcam does not have both incoming and outgoing connection prevleges. Anyway, go into your firewall and then find the section which lists all of your system and programs with connection priveleges. Check the setting and change as needed. You may need to make an exception for this webcam.

If you are having problems with this, go to the McAfee support site and access the chat option. You will be connected to a technician right away and that person will tell you how to fix this. The chat session with a technician is free of charge. I so suggest you go into your firewall and look for the setting area I suggested above first however. This way you can tell the technicain exactly what you have tried so far. When you contact the technician have your webcam model ready.
